How To Develop Your Core Competencies

How To Develop Your Core Competencies

We all want to be good at something. Whether it’s our job, a hobby, or a sport, we all want to be competent and skilled. And while some people are born with a natural talent for certain things, for the rest of us, becoming competent takes time, effort, and practice.

If you’re looking to develop your own core competencies, here are a few tips to get you started:

Define what you want to be good at.

The first step to becoming good at anything is to have a clear goal in mind. What is it that you want to be good at? Be specific. Once you have a clear goal, you can start planning your path to competence.

Find a role model.

One of the best ways to become good at something is to find someone who is already good at it and copy them. Find a role model in your chosen field and study everything they do. See how they approach problems and how they solve them. Try to imitate their methods and learn from their successes (and failures).

Get some practice.

No one becomes good at something without practice. If you want to develop your core competencies, you need to put in the time and effort to learn and improve. This means making mistakes, trying new things, and constantly pushing yourself to get better.

Be patient.

Rome wasn’t built in a day, and neither are core competencies. Developing competence takes time, so be patient with yourself. Don’t expect to become an expert overnight – it takes time, effort, and practice to get good at anything.

Enjoy the journey.

Becoming good at something can be a long and difficult journey, but it’s also an immensely rewarding one. So, enjoy the process and savor every victory, no matter how small. Remember, the journey is just as important as the destination.
